Roles and Responsibilities

Responsible for the Project Developer, Renewable Energy position include development activities for wind, solar and renewable energy project sites through the development cycle, from site identification through to NTP. Specific duties to include, but not limited to:

Planning and Management

  • Identify development prospects, conduct fatal flaw review, and initial site reconnaissance.
  • Probe and research potential project sites and communities.
  • Conduct project feasibility evaluation.
  • Develop and execute project development strategy and plans.
  • Execute all project development activities including:
  • Project schedules (MS Project) identifying critical path activities, maintain critical issues list.
  • Update project budgets and cash flow projections, completing requested management reporting and tracking.
  • Comply with project related contract & regulatory compliance.
  • Complete tasks according to budgets and schedules, including coordinating with internal and external technical support as assigned.
  • Interface with subject matter experts/contractors, including those related to project resource assessment, interconnection, project design, financial modelling, regulatory and legislative matters, environmental and wildlife studies, and permitting.

Land

  • Accountable for the acquisition plan for new project sites, which may include: hiring local residents, establishing local offices, funding local initiatives, establishing relationships, and generally developing alliances with the community that will support site development.
  • Plan for and secure site control, including but not limited to: overseeing internal and contract land agents responsible for land acquisition, meeting with property owners and their representatives to discuss project plans (and design as necessary) and acquire real estate rights to support project development.
  • Coordinate and plan landowner meetings and community events.
  • Produce and maintain accurate landowner contact records for parcel files consistent with the company real estate inventory database.
  • Coordinate communications with landowners as necessary during development/pre‐construction.
  • Manage relationships with customers, landowners, state and local officials and other stakeholders to achieve a positive reputation, etc.

Resource Assessment

  • Coordinate site resource monitoring deployment and data management.
  • Support the completion of resource assessment reports.

Environmental and Permitting

  • Research local, state and federal regulations on project development to incorporate into project plan.
  • Manage consultant(s) responsible for permitting and regulatory tasks.
  • Support the state, federal and local permitting processes, including application preparation, review of contractor reports, overall permitting, representing the company during the permitting process as assigned.
  • Support the project team through all necessary environmental studies.

Origination

  • Assist and support origination of project offtake opportunities.
  • Create support materials for offtake opportunities including RFPs.
